[Intel-gfx] [PATCH] drm/i915: Use dev_priv as first argument of for_each_pipe()

Damien Lespiau damien.lespiau at intel.com
Fri Aug 15 19:34:06 CEST 2014


Chris has decided that enough is enough. It's time to fixup dev Vs
dev_priv and the, oh so awful, INTEL_INFO(). This is a modest
contribution to the crusade.

Suggested-by: Chris Wilson <chris at chris-wilson.co.uk>
Signed-off-by: Damien Lespiau <damien.lespiau at intel.com>

diff --git a/drivers/gpu/drm/i915/i915_drv.h b/drivers/gpu/drm/i915/i915_drv.h
index 4754328..e07419d 100644
--- a/drivers/gpu/drm/i915/i915_drv.h
+++ b/drivers/gpu/drm/i915/i915_drv.h
@@ -163,7 +163,7 @@ enum hpd_pin {
 	 I915_GEM_DOMAIN_INSTRUCTION | \
 	 I915_GEM_DOMAIN_VERTEX)
 
-#define for_each_pipe(p) for ((p) = 0; (p) < INTEL_INFO(dev)->num_pipes; (p)++)
+#define for_each_pipe(dev, p) for ((p) = 0; (p) < (dev)->info.num_pipes; (p)++)
 #define for_each_sprite(p, s) for ((s) = 0; (s) < INTEL_INFO(dev)->num_sprites[(p)]; (s)++)
 
 #define for_each_crtc(dev, crtc) \
